The fruit for the Scopa Siciliane rosso comes from organically farmed vineyards in Partinico, province of Palermo, at 400msl. The Nero d'Avola and Perricone are planted at southern exposure; the Nerello Mascalese at northern. Soil in general throughout the vineyards is 40% sand, 30% loam, 30% clay.
